Two glasshouse experiments were done to assess the development and metabolic activity of mycorrhizas formed by isolates of
arbuscular mycorrhizal fungi (AMF) from three different genera, Acaulospora, Gigaspora and Glomus on either Pueraria phaseoloides L. or Desmodium ovalifolium L. plants. The second of the two experiments included three levels of a localised phosphate source in the pots. Alkaline
phosphatase (ALP), stained histochemically in the intra-radical mycelium (IRM) of AMF over sequential harvests, did not provide
a direct marker for the efficiency of AMF in mobilising phosphorus (P) for plant growth and development. The ability of the
extra-radical mycelium (ERM) to scavenge a localised phosphate source, determined by its extraction from buried 35-μm mesh
pouches, was dependent on the species of AMF tested. This work indicates that AMF from different genera have unique patterns
of mycelial development when forming mycorrhizas with tropical hosts in the presence of a localised phosphate source. AMF
also appear to have different mechanisms for the control of P transfer, within the mycelium, to the host. The significance
of the architecture of the ERM is discussed as well as the localisation of ALP in the IRM in determining the efficiency of
AMF in terms of P accumulation in planta and subsequent growth of plants.

Analogues of bicuculline devoid of the benzo ring fused to the lactone moiety were prepared by reacting 2-(tert-butyl-dimethylsiloxy)furans with 3,4-dihydroisoquinolinium salts. Some of these compounds (e.g., ROD185, 8) acted as modulators of the GABAA receptor, displacing ligands of the benzodiazepine binding site. They also strongly stimulated GABA currents mediated by recombinant GABA(A) receptors expressed in Xenopus oocytes. 相似文献

Background
South Africa has one of the highest per capita rates of tuberculosis (TB) incidence in the world. In 2012, the South African government produced a National Strategic Plan (NSP) to control the spread of TB with the ambitious aim of zero new TB infections and deaths by 2032, and a halving of the 2012 rates by 2016.Methods
We used a transmission model to investigate whether the NSP targets could be reached if immediate scale up of control methods had happened in 2014. We explored the potential impact of four intervention portfolios; 1) “NSP” represents the NSP strategy, 2) “WHO” investigates increasing antiretroviral therapy eligibility, 3) “Novel Strategies” considers new isoniazid preventive therapy strategies and HIV “Universal Test and Treat” and 4) “Optimised” contains the most effective interventions.Findings
We find that even with this scale-up, the NSP targets are unlikely to be achieved. The portfolio that achieved the greatest impact was “Optimised”, followed closely by “NSP”. The “WHO” and “Novel Strategies” had little impact on TB incidence by 2050. Of the individual interventions explored, the most effective were active case finding and reductions in pre-treatment loss to follow up which would have a large impact on TB burden.Conclusion
Use of existing control strategies has the potential to have a large impact on TB disease burden in South Africa. However, our results suggest that the South African TB targets are unlikely to be reached without new technologies. Despite this, TB incidence could be dramatically reduced by finding and starting more TB cases on treatment. 相似文献144.

Most perfusion techniques rely on mechanical means to provide blood flow to the isolated organ for maintaining its physiological conditions. The approach usually requires a complicated mechanical system with the associated problems of blood type matching and prevention of blood cell damage. This paper describes a gastrointestinal tract perfusion technique that uses the rabbit's own cardiopulmonary system as the autologous blood supply source. The technique allows for the removal of the complete intestinal loop from the abdominal cavity of the rabbit, and maintains its blood circulation through silastic tubing connections of the catheterized portal vein and cranial and caudal mesenteric arteries. An alternative perfusion site that uses the aorta as the arterial blood supply and the vena cava as the venous return also is described. The isolated perfused GI tract may then be placed in a separate test environment for controlled experiments. For an acute animal test, the approach was found to be a convenient alternative to conventional approaches. 相似文献

Increase in microbial contamination of defeathering machinery in a poultry processing plant after changes in the method of processing 总被引:1,自引:1,他引:0
The numbers of coliforms, Enterobacteriaceae and Staphylococcus aureus and the extent of their colonization of the fingers of the defeathering machinery within a poultry processing plant were increased after changes in machinery design and a reduction in the level of chlorination. Such increases and the pattern of contamination suggested that the changes had allowed an endemic flora to develop on the fingers. 相似文献

Summary Tadpoles and young toads of Xenopus laevis were maintained in aqueous solutions of potassium perchlorate or thiourea (0.005% or 0.01% w/v) for up to 20 months. Metamorphosis of tadpoles was inhibited. Within a short time large well-vascularized goitres developed in both tadpoles and toads. An ultrastructural investigation of some of the follicular epithelial cells of these goitres revealed some unusual cytoplasmic membranous inclusions and a morphological account of these structures is presented. It is suggested that some of these complex membranous inclusions may give rise to cytosomes.
